We have 8439 coming up and were told that these are some of the best cabins on the boat by many. The only knock that I have heard is that if you're a late sleeper you may hear some chair scraping above you on the Lido deck, and that there is not the breeze you get from the side balconies - for us in March, probably great - not sure about June.
